The carbon carbon bond length in benzene is

A

in between `C_(2)H_(6) and C_(2)H_(4)`

B

Same as in `C_(2)H_(4)`

C

In between `C_(2)H_(6) and C_(2)H_(2)`

D

In between `C_(2)H_(4) and C_(2)H_(2)`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A

Bonds in bezene have partrical double bond character. Therefore the C-C bond length in benzene is between `C_(2)H_(6)` (single bond) and `C_(2)H_(4)` (double bond)
